On appeal from the disposition of the Ontario Review Board dated November 27, 2003.
A P P E A L B O O K E N D O R S E M E N T
[1] Although the Board did not have the benefit of the most recent jurisprudence from the SCC, it is clear from the reasons that the conditions imposed were the “least onerous and restrictive possible”.
[2] Overall, the Board’s decision was reasonable and consistent with the available evidence.
[3] Accordingly, the appeal is dismissed.
